The Present: Arkansas’s Biggest City Right Now

According to the most recent data available, Little Rock is the largest city in Arkansas. Little Rock, the state’s capital and center of government, business, and culture, is tucked away on the banks of the Arkansas River. The city, which boasts a rich historical history and a diverse population, exemplifies the fusion of modern progress and Southern hospitality.

Economic Hub: With a diversified economy encompassing industries like healthcare, education, government, and manufacturing, Little Rock is the state’s economic engine. The city’s status as a regional economic powerhouse has been bolstered by its advantageous location and conducive business environment.

Cultural Center: Offering both locals and tourists a wide range of museums, theaters, and cultural events, Arkansas’s largest city is also a cultural melting pot. Little Rock is a testament to a dedication to conserving history and promoting modern arts and culture, as evidenced by the Clinton Presidential Library and the bustling River Market District.

Academic Prominence: The city of Little Rock is a hub for research and education, home to esteemed establishments such as the University of Arkansas for Medical Sciences (UAMS) and the University of Arkansas at Little Rock. These establishments support the local economy by providing trained labor, in addition to enhancing the academic environment.
